Perfect Square
706732518003608740637211513765129 is a perfect square (26584441276874877 × 26584441276874877)
706732518003608740637211513765129 is a perfect square (26584441276874877 × 26584441276874877)
706732518003608740637211513765129 is odd
Previous odd number is 706732518003608740637211513765127
Next odd number is 706732518003608740637211513765131
10001011011000001101111110110100100111010000110010110001101111101100001001110101111011000101101011110100001001
352992292905997656388653679726693259546272385186732753993727944770900562596861224458074438767241689
499470852003721152714703858252629219292052056529767185045776386641